How they compare

Cuba currently reports 0.202 m3 per square kilometre against 0.1646 m3 per square kilometre in Bangladesh, a difference of 0.0374 m3 per square kilometre.

That makes Cuba's figure about 1.2 times Bangladesh's.

The two have swapped places 11 times across 32 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Bangladesh ahead.

Bangladesh ranks 137th and Cuba ranks 134th of 184 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Bangladesh averaged higher in 2 and Cuba in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bangladesh Cuba Difference Ahead
1990s 0.0228 m3 per square kilometre 0.0626 m3 per square kilometre 0.0399 m3 per square kilometre Cuba
2000s 0.1293 m3 per square kilometre 0.2219 m3 per square kilometre 0.0926 m3 per square kilometre Cuba
2010s 0.2552 m3 per square kilometre 0.2092 m3 per square kilometre 0.046 m3 per square kilometre Bangladesh
2020s 0.291 m3 per square kilometre 0.1942 m3 per square kilometre 0.0968 m3 per square kilometre Bangladesh

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
